1. Статьи
  2. Основные преимущества балансировки нагрузки базы данных для вашего магазина электронной коммерции
Для доступа к заказчикам и разработчикам необходимо авторизоваться
11 октября 2021 в 13:43

Балансировка нагрузки базы данных имеет решающее значение, когда речь идет о вашем бизнесе электронной коммерции. Это связано с тем, что он играет важную роль в обеспечении прозрачности между вашей базой данных SQL и приложением электронной коммерции . То есть балансировка нагрузки обеспечивает репликацию вашей базы данных, а также аварийное переключение, чтобы обеспечить постоянную доступность вашего приложения электронной коммерции.

Основные преимущества балансировки нагрузки базы данных для вашего магазина электронной коммерции

Таким образом, с балансировкой нагрузки базы данных вы гарантированно обеспечите 100% безотказную работу даже в дни, когда ваш сайт получает большой трафик, например, Черная пятница . Балансировка нагрузки базы данных также способствует высокой производительности, так что ваш веб-сайт доступен. Кроме того, он позволяет масштабироваться по требованию с увеличением кривой продаж и развертывать исправления безопасности, чтобы избежать простоев или потери доходов. В конечном итоге балансировка нагрузки базы данных зависит от того, что она поддерживает масштабируемость.

Масштабируемость - важный фактор, который следует учитывать при выборе платформы электронной коммерции. То есть ваш сайт должен иметь возможность не только меняться, но и расти, удовлетворяя спрос. Среди важнейших компонентов, которые напрямую влияют на масштабируемость вашей платформы электронной коммерции, - база данных. Это фундаментальная часть вашей платформы электронной коммерции, поэтому ее масштабируемость определенно определит, как сайт может расширяться. Чтобы определить, насколько масштабируема ваша база данных, вам нужно обратить внимание на различные возможности.

Ваша база данных электронной торговли содержит различные поля информации, которые включают информацию о ваших продуктах, такую ​​как цвета, размеры и количество, а также информацию о ваших клиентах, которая включает информацию о платеже, их имена, а также контактную информацию. Итак, как вы собираетесь привлечь больше клиентов и добавить больше продуктов? Здесь на помощь приходит концепция базы данных, которая легко масштабируется. По возможности не должно быть необходимости во вмешательстве разработчика для обеспечения роста. Это также должно относиться к отношениям, в которых администраторы могут просто добавлять отношения, определяющие новые рабочие процессы, без необходимости в ИТ-поддержке.

Масштабируемость инфраструктуры баз данных

Масштабируемость инфраструктуры вашей базы данных также жизненно важна для вашей базы данных. Этого также можно достичь за счет балансировки нагрузки. . То есть распределение данных по разным серверам для удовлетворения огромного спроса на вашем сайте электронной коммерции. Следовательно, если ваша база данных выйдет из строя, наличие опции аварийного переключения, когда резервный сервер заменяет базу данных, гарантирует, что ваш веб-сайт по-прежнему будет доступен. Также стоит принять во внимание тот факт, что выбор облачной базы данных - отличный способ повысить масштабируемость инфраструктуры вашей базы данных. Это связано с тем, что облачная инфраструктура чрезвычайно масштабируема благодаря тому, что облако, в котором хранятся ваши данные, растет вместе с ростом вашего бизнеса. В конечном итоге вам необходимо знать максимальную нагрузку, которую ваша база данных может выдержать в зависимости от вашей системы.

Как выбрать масштабируемую базу данных

При выборе масштабируемой базы данных критически важно учитывать скорость ввода / вывода (IO) и блокировки, базовое программное обеспечение, а также способ, которым оно обрабатывает запросы на обработку. В целом, использование конфигурации твердотельного жесткого диска для запросов ввода-вывода считается лучшим способом обработки запросов, таких как транзакции. В случае, если мощность программного и аппаратного обеспечения не соответствует требованиям ввода-вывода, может возникнуть проблема с блокировкой. Однако масштабируемость можно улучшить за счет оптимизации запросов, чтобы уменьшить их требования к базе данных.

Кэширование и индексирование также могут помочь повысить масштабируемость

Кэширование и индексирование также способствуют повышению масштабируемости, поскольку они минимизируют потребность в аппаратных ресурсах. Создание кеша часто запрашиваемых запросов означает, что вывод будет под рукой, а не будет извлекаться всякий раз, когда есть запрос. Активация индексации и интеллектуального кэширования также удобна при работе с высокочастотными транзакциями без нагрузки на аппаратные ресурсы. Транзакции с высокой стоимостью или высокой частотой можно легко идентифицировать и перехватывать с помощью подходящих инструментов. Индексированная и кэшированная информация может затем использоваться для помощи в завершении транзакций, а не для увеличения нагрузки на оборудование. Внедрение этих улучшений помогает не только расширять базу данных, но и лучше масштабировать ее.

Плохо масштабируемая база данных электронной коммерции может означать катастрофу

Отсутствие масштабируемости вашей базы данных электронной коммерции может означать только катастрофу для вашего бизнеса. То есть, если ваш сайт не может расти, чтобы соответствовать спросу, он может зависнуть и выйти из строя из-за огромной нагрузки на серверы. Когда сайт выйдет из строя, вы потеряете не только клиентов, но и продажи. Кроме того, вам, возможно, придется разорвать и заменить платформу электронной коммерции, что будет стоить вам денег и времени. Таким образом, выбор платформы, предназначенной для обеспечения роста, может уберечь вашу электронную коммерцию от проблем. Следовательно, имея базу данных, которая хорошо масштабируется благодаря способности масштабировать различные отношения и поля базы данных и имея правильную инфраструктуру базы данных, вы гарантируете, что ваш веб-сайт электронной коммерции будет хорошо справляться с ростом, даже когда ваш веб-сайт растет.

В целом масштабируемость - это ключ к огромным различиям в потенциале роста вашей компании, а также в прибылях. Таким образом, вам будет полезно изучить все варианты улучшения масштабируемости ваших баз данных за счет балансировки нагрузки, чтобы удовлетворить все потребности вашего бизнеса в масштабируемости.

Таким образом, важно выбрать масштабируемый веб-сайт, чтобы ваш бизнес мог справляться с ростом при росте спроса, тем самым помогая вашему бизнесу развиваться. Вы можете добиться этого с помощью балансировки нагрузки базы данных, которая гарантирует вам стабильную работу даже в те дни, когда ваш сайт получает большой трафик, например, в Черную пятницу. Таким образом, вы будете уверены не только в расширении своего бизнеса, но и в росте и сохранении клиентов благодаря высококачественному обслуживанию, которое они получают в вашем магазине электронной коммерции.

Ищете программное обеспечение для электронной коммерции? Ознакомьтесь со списком лучших программных решений для электронной коммерции Platforms .